Have a 2003 cl-s. bought the car with 28k miles and put on 40k miles in about a year. problem i am having is my oem rotors had to be machined three times in one year. the third time i just replaced them for discitalia slotted and drilled rotos with ceramicool pads. i have had that combo for 12k miles and am starting to feel pulsation again. i am totally lost and get the feeling it isn't the rotors. i do not drive crazy, just a normal everday driver that puts on a lot of highway miles.

Low-to-medium speed shimmy with brakes not applied is a good indicator
of a ply-separated (ie: dangerous) tire, most likely in the front.


The pulsation under braking is probably the front brake rotors. Turned rotors are more prone to warpage.



Have both issued checked at a full-service tire/service center - no Wal-Mart/Sam's Club crap.
